Abstract
The present invention provides a kind of anti-splash device of gyratory crusher, anti-splash device includes the oil baffle filler ring for being fixed on sealing drum inner ring top, oil baffle filler ring top is placed with splash ring, being horizontally disposed between splash ring and sealing drum outer ring has oil baffle, oil baffle filler ring lower part is provided with oil baffle fixed ring, oil baffle filler ring oil return hole is provided on oil baffle filler ring, oil baffle fixed ring oil return hole is provided in oil baffle fixed ring, oil baffle filler ring oil return hole does not correspond setting up and down with oil baffle fixed ring oil return hole, sealing drum forms sealing drum U-type groove structure with anti-splash device.The present invention solves the problems, such as that welding steel connection bolt assembly reduces main axe intensity on main shaft, and splash ring is directly placed above oil baffle filler ring without limiting its freedom, solves the problems, such as that bolt assembly installation is inconvenient;Certain gap is provided between splash ring and main shaft can substantially reduce its abraded contact area, solve the problems, such as material quick abrasion.

Background technology
Gyratory crusher is a kind of novel, circular cone broken crusher, in Mineral Processing Industry market prospects broken instead of thin Hubei Province
It is long-range.Its workpiece is the breaker roll of a revolution at a high speed, the roller and a pair of of the curved shape crushing shell coupling being symmetrical set
It is combined into two and clamps the optimization crusher chamber expected, so that breaker roll is done lateral swing campaign under spindle eccentricity effect, be allowed to generate
Powerful cycle extrusion power, the continuous progressive material in two crusher chambers is alternately broken, product from two discharge gates not
It is discharged disconnectedly.The rotation of gyratory crusher is to drive the operating of gyratory crusher, bearing rotating by the rotation of bearing
It needs to reduce friction by lubricating oil in journey, the service life is improved, if but lubricating oil used during oil lubrication
Will mostly lubricating oil be made to splash inside machine, it is therefore desirable to which anti-splash device is installed on gyratory crusher.
As shown in Figure 1, for the anti-splash device of existing gyratory crusher, the welding steel b on main shaft a, steel plate b pass through spiral shell
Bolt assembly is connected with anti-splash device c, and anti-splash device c is folder cloth conveyer belt or rubber type of material, presss from both sides cloth conveyer belt or rubber
Class material extend into sealing drum lower part, and anti-splash device c is vertically arranged.There are following drawbacks for this anti-splash device:First, main
The thing that axis is generally forging welding steel class on it can cause stress concentration, damage main axe intensity;Second is that main shaft is in reality
Meeting continuous action in work, presss from both sides cloth conveyer belt or rubber type of material is fixed on main shaft abrasion meeting quickly;Third, bolt and nut is pacified
If dress can touch dust ring towards outside, nut and/or bolt thread, bolt and nut must be directed towards inside installation very not
It is convenient;Fourth, being easy to block oil return hole after folder cloth conveyer belt or rubber type of material damage, cause a large amount of lubricating oil from dust-proof ring region
Domain leaks.

Specific implementation mode
Present invention will be further explained below with reference to the attached drawings and specific embodiments.
As in Figure 2-4, the present invention provides a kind of novel gyratory crusher anti-splash device, including rack 1, rack 1
Internal vertical is provided with main shaft 2, and main shaft lower outside is equipped with eccentric bushing 6, and the setting of 2 upper outside of main shaft is fluted, in groove
Main shaft circumferencial direction is provided with sealing drum 3,3 outer lower side of sealing drum is provided with dust ring 4.Sealing drum 3 is by sealing drum
Circle 32, sealing drum outer ring 33 and sealing drum bottom composition, the height of sealing drum outer ring 33 is higher than the height of sealing drum inner ring 32, close
32 top of sealed tube inner ring is provided with anti-splash device 5.Sealing drum lower end is provided with sealing drum oil return hole 34, sealing drum oil return hole 34
Setting is corresponded with rack oil return hole 11, the quantity of sealing drum oil return hole 34 is one or more.It is set on sealing drum inner ring 32
It is equipped with sealing drum oilhole 31, sealing drum oilhole 31 corresponds setting, sealing drum profit with eccentric bushing oilhole 61
The quantity of lubrication hole 31 is one or more.
As shown in figure 5, anti-splash device 5 includes the oil baffle filler ring 53 for being fixed on 32 top of sealing drum inner ring, oil baffle
53 top of filler ring is placed with splash ring 51, and being horizontally disposed between splash ring 51 and sealing drum outer ring 33 has oil baffle 52, splash ring
51 thickness is more than the thickness of oil baffle 52, and 53 lower part of oil baffle filler ring is provided with oil baffle fixed ring 54, oil baffle 52, gear oil
Plate support ring 53 and oil baffle fixed ring 54 are fixed together by bolt assembly.Oil baffle filler ring is provided on oil baffle filler ring 53
Oil return hole 531 is provided with oil baffle fixed ring oil return hole 541, oil baffle filler ring oil return hole 531 and gear in oil baffle fixed ring 54
About 541 oiled-plate method fixed ring oil return hole does not correspond setting, and sealing drum 3 forms sealing drum U-type groove structure with anti-splash device 5
543.The quantity of oil baffle filler ring oil return hole 531 is one or more, the quantity of oil baffle fixed ring oil return hole 541 be one or
It is multiple.
Oil baffle 52 is made of flexible material, can be made of materials such as rubber or resins, outside oil baffle filler ring 53
Diameter is equal with the interior diameter of sealing drum outer ring 33, and the overall diameter of oil baffle 52 is more than the interior diameter of sealing drum outer ring 33, can
Prevent lubricating oil from being moved upwards from sealing drum outer tube inner wall.
It is provided with certain gap between splash ring 51 and main shaft 2, the abraded contact area to main shaft can be substantially reduced.
For gyratory crusher in normal operation work, lubricating oil is from eccentric bushing oilhole 61 and sealing drum oilhole 31
Into sealing drum U-type groove structure 543, the rack oil return hole 11 then opened up along sealing drum oil return hole 34 and rack flows into gear
Inside case;If big in the inside of sealing drum U-type groove structure 543 lubricating oil pressure, lubricating oil if, can move upwards, if by gear
Oiled-plate method fixed ring oil return hole 541, and oil baffle fixed ring oil return hole 541 and oil baffle filler ring oil return hole 531 be not corresponding, great Liang Run
Lubricating oil will not then continue directly to move upwards;If by the gap between 32 inner wall of sealing drum inner ring and oil baffle fixed ring 54
Upwards, oil baffle filler ring 53, a large amount of lubricating oil then do not continue directly to move upwards above it;When a small amount of lubricating oil enters
When 51 top of splash ring, by oil baffle filler ring oil return hole 531 and the oil baffle fixed ring oil return hole 541 not being correspondingly arranged with it
Sealing drum U-type groove structure 543 is flowed back to, prevents a large amount of lubricating oil from the purpose of 4 area leakage of dust ring to realize.
